Pr Secy chairs Public Darbar, addresses community issues & concerns

Samba : Principal Secretary, PWD (R&B), Shailendra Kumar, on Tuesday chaired a Public Darbar at Anandpur panchayat of Purmandal block here, to address community issues and concerns.
The event recorded several crucial issues pertaining to road connectivity in Khara upper and lower areas besides Karad, Amli and Sumb areas, construction of bridge at Madana, road repairs, construction of bridge from Uttarbehni to Sangar, finalization of DPR for Health and Wellness Centre at Katwalta Panchayat and construction of well in Deon area.
A comprehensive memorandum of demands was submitted by Avtar Singh, DDC member Purmandal and Arshad Begum, BDC Chairman Purmandal. Besides, DDC Vice Chairperson Samba, Balwan Singh also submitted a memorandum of demands with request to enhance connectivity in remote block of Sumb.
Chairman DDC Samba, Keshav Dutt Sharma applauded the government’s efforts to engage with citizens through initiatives like Public Darbar and Back to Village, emphasizing the importance of understanding the people’s pressing demands.
Principal Secretary reaffirmed the government’s commitment towards prioritizing connectivity in remote and far-flung areas. He highlighted the significant increase in road construction and blacktopping activities in recent years.
Deputy Commissioner Samba, Abhishek Sharma, highlighted achievements registered in the district, such as saturation of Golden Cards in 96 Panchayats, completion of 83 schemes under Jal Jeevan Mission, and enrollment of almost 1% of total population on Daksh Kisan portal under HADP.
The event was also attended by ADDC Samba, Rajinder Singh, Sarpanchs, PRIs and all district and sectoral officers of district administration.
